Over the past few decades, additive manufacturing, more commonly known as 3D printing, has revolutionized the way products are designed and produced. In particular, metal additive manufacturing has gained significant traction in industries such as aerospace, automotive, and healthcare due to its ability to create complex geometries and functional parts with superior mechanical properties. One of the key advantages of exhibition metal additive manufacturing is the opportunity to see firsthand the incredible potential of this technology. Additive manufacturing enables the production of complex geometries and lightweight structures that would be impossible to achieve using traditional manufacturing methods. By layering materials one thin layer at a time, metal 3D printers can create intricate designs with unparalleled precision and accuracy, opening up new possibilities for product design and customization.

In addition to showcasing the capabilities of metal additive manufacturing, exhibitions also provide a platform for companies to introduce new materials and processes that push the boundaries of what is possible with this technology. Innovations such as metal powder bed fusion, directed energy deposition, and binder jetting have expanded the range of materials that can be used in additive manufacturing, including titanium, aluminum, stainless steel, and nickel alloys. These advancements have enabled the production of high-performance components for critical applications in industries such as aerospace, defense, and medical devices.
